Normally, yes.

The max speed of the most common wireless standard, 802.11g, is about 54 Mbps while the router will support wired transfer speeds of 100 Mbps or 1000 Mbps (Gigabit network).

Your internet connection is slower than either of those, broadband internet is in the range 1-10 Mbps, so you won't notice if you use the wireless just for browsing.

The speed difference between wired and wireless is definitely noticeable when you copy files between two computers on the local network.

Q: Is wireless slower than wired if it comes from the same router from the same adsl connection?
